Subject: [PATCH v5 15/21] ASoC: SOF: Intel: Add platform differentiation for APL and CNL
Date: Fri, 12 Apr 2019 11:08:58 -0500	[thread overview]
Message-ID: <20190412160904.30418-16-pierre-louis.bossart@linux.intel.com> (raw)
In-Reply-To: <20190412160904.30418-1-pierre-louis.bossart@linux.intel.com>

From: Liam Girdwood <liam.r.girdwood@linux.intel.com>

Add platform differentiation operations for different Intel HDA DSP
platforms.

Signed-off-by: Keyon Jie <yang.jie@linux.intel.com>
Signed-off-by: Liam Girdwood <liam.r.girdwood@linux.intel.com>
Signed-off-by: Pierre-Louis Bossart <pierre-louis.bossart@linux.intel.com>
---
 sound/soc/sof/intel/apl.c | 109 +++++++++++++++++
 sound/soc/sof/intel/cnl.c | 249 ++++++++++++++++++++++++++++++++++++++
 2 files changed, 358 insertions(+)
 create mode 100644 sound/soc/sof/intel/apl.c
 create mode 100644 sound/soc/sof/intel/cnl.c

diff --git a/sound/soc/sof/intel/cnl.c b/sound/soc/sof/intel/cnl.c
new file mode 100644
index 000000000000..3e95c1e5e491
--- /dev/null
+++ b/sound/soc/sof/intel/cnl.c
@@ -0,0 +1,249 @@
+// SPDX-License-Identifier: (GPL-2.0 OR BSD-3-Clause)
+//
+// This file is provided under a dual BSD/GPLv2 license.  When using or
+// redistributing this file, you may do so under either license.
+//
+// Copyright(c) 2018 Intel Corporation. All rights reserved.
+//
+// Authors: Liam Girdwood <liam.r.girdwood@linux.intel.com>
+//	    Ranjani Sridharan <ranjani.sridharan@linux.intel.com>
+//	    Rander Wang <rander.wang@intel.com>
+//          Keyon Jie <yang.jie@linux.intel.com>
+//
+
+/*
+ * Hardware interface for audio DSP on Cannonlake.
+ */
+
+#include "../ops.h"
+#include "hda.h"
+
+static const struct snd_sof_debugfs_map cnl_dsp_debugfs[] = {
+	{"hda", HDA_DSP_HDA_BAR, 0, 0x4000, SOF_DEBUGFS_ACCESS_ALWAYS},
+	{"pp", HDA_DSP_PP_BAR,  0, 0x1000, SOF_DEBUGFS_ACCESS_ALWAYS},
+	{"dsp", HDA_DSP_BAR,  0, 0x10000, SOF_DEBUGFS_ACCESS_ALWAYS},
+};
+
+static void cnl_ipc_host_done(struct snd_sof_dev *sdev);
+static void cnl_ipc_dsp_done(struct snd_sof_dev *sdev);
+
+static irqreturn_t cnl_ipc_irq_thread(int irq, void *context)
+{
+	struct snd_sof_dev *sdev = context;
+	u32 hipci;
+	u32 hipcctl;
+	u32 hipcida;
+	u32 hipctdr;
+	u32 hipctdd;
+	u32 msg;
+	u32 msg_ext;
+	irqreturn_t ret = IRQ_NONE;
+
+	/* here we handle IPC interrupts only */
+	if (!(sdev->irq_status & HDA_DSP_ADSPIS_IPC))
+		return ret;
+
+	hipcida = snd_sof_dsp_read(sdev, HDA_DSP_BAR, CNL_DSP_REG_HIPCIDA);
+	hipcctl = snd_sof_dsp_read(sdev, HDA_DSP_BAR, CNL_DSP_REG_HIPCCTL);
+	hipctdr = snd_sof_dsp_read(sdev, HDA_DSP_BAR, CNL_DSP_REG_HIPCTDR);
+
+	/* reenable IPC interrupt */
+	snd_sof_dsp_update_bits(sdev, HDA_DSP_BAR, HDA_DSP_REG_ADSPIC,
+				HDA_DSP_ADSPIC_IPC, HDA_DSP_ADSPIC_IPC);
+
+	/* reply message from DSP */
+	if (hipcida & CNL_DSP_REG_HIPCIDA_DONE &&
+	    hipcctl & CNL_DSP_REG_HIPCCTL_DONE) {
+		hipci = snd_sof_dsp_read(sdev, HDA_DSP_BAR,
+					 CNL_DSP_REG_HIPCIDR);
+		msg_ext = hipci & CNL_DSP_REG_HIPCIDR_MSG_MASK;
+		msg = hipcida & CNL_DSP_REG_HIPCIDA_MSG_MASK;
+
+		dev_vdbg(sdev->dev,
+			 "ipc: firmware response, msg:0x%x, msg_ext:0x%x\n",
+			 msg, msg_ext);
+
+		/* mask Done interrupt */
+		snd_sof_dsp_update_bits(sdev, HDA_DSP_BAR,
+					CNL_DSP_REG_HIPCCTL,
+					CNL_DSP_REG_HIPCCTL_DONE, 0);
+
+		/* handle immediate reply from DSP core */
+		hda_dsp_ipc_get_reply(sdev);
+		snd_sof_ipc_reply(sdev, msg);
+
+		if (sdev->code_loading)	{
+			sdev->code_loading = 0;
+			wake_up(&sdev->waitq);
+		}
+
+		cnl_ipc_dsp_done(sdev);
+
+		ret = IRQ_HANDLED;
+	}
+
+	/* new message from DSP */
+	if (hipctdr & CNL_DSP_REG_HIPCTDR_BUSY) {
+		hipctdd = snd_sof_dsp_read(sdev, HDA_DSP_BAR,
+					   CNL_DSP_REG_HIPCTDD);
+		msg = hipctdr & CNL_DSP_REG_HIPCTDR_MSG_MASK;
+		msg_ext = hipctdd & CNL_DSP_REG_HIPCTDD_MSG_MASK;
+
+		dev_vdbg(sdev->dev,
+			 "ipc: firmware initiated, msg:0x%x, msg_ext:0x%x\n",
+			 msg, msg_ext);
+
+		/* handle messages from DSP */
+		if ((hipctdr & SOF_IPC_PANIC_MAGIC_MASK) ==
+		   SOF_IPC_PANIC_MAGIC) {
+			snd_sof_dsp_panic(sdev, HDA_DSP_PANIC_OFFSET(msg_ext));
+		} else {
+			snd_sof_ipc_msgs_rx(sdev);
+		}
+
+		/*
+		 * clear busy interrupt to tell dsp controller this
+		 * interrupt has been accepted, not trigger it again
+		 */
+		snd_sof_dsp_update_bits_forced(sdev, HDA_DSP_BAR,
+					       CNL_DSP_REG_HIPCTDR,
+					       CNL_DSP_REG_HIPCTDR_BUSY,
+					       CNL_DSP_REG_HIPCTDR_BUSY);
+
+		cnl_ipc_host_done(sdev);
+
+		ret = IRQ_HANDLED;
+	}
+
+	return ret;
+}
+
+static void cnl_ipc_host_done(struct snd_sof_dev *sdev)
+{
+	/*
+	 * set done bit to ack dsp the msg has been
+	 * processed and send reply msg to dsp
+	 */
+	snd_sof_dsp_update_bits_forced(sdev, HDA_DSP_BAR,
+				       CNL_DSP_REG_HIPCTDA,
+				       CNL_DSP_REG_HIPCTDA_DONE,
+				       CNL_DSP_REG_HIPCTDA_DONE);
+}
+
+static void cnl_ipc_dsp_done(struct snd_sof_dev *sdev)
+{
+	/*
+	 * set DONE bit - tell DSP we have received the reply msg
+	 * from DSP, and processed it, don't send more reply to host
+	 */
+	snd_sof_dsp_update_bits_forced(sdev, HDA_DSP_BAR,
+				       CNL_DSP_REG_HIPCIDA,
+				       CNL_DSP_REG_HIPCIDA_DONE,
+				       CNL_DSP_REG_HIPCIDA_DONE);
+
+	/* unmask Done interrupt */
+	snd_sof_dsp_update_bits(sdev, HDA_DSP_BAR,
+				CNL_DSP_REG_HIPCCTL,
+				CNL_DSP_REG_HIPCCTL_DONE,
+				CNL_DSP_REG_HIPCCTL_DONE);
+}
+
+static int cnl_ipc_send_msg(struct snd_sof_dev *sdev,
+			    struct snd_sof_ipc_msg *msg)
+{
+	u32 cmd = msg->header;
+
+	/* send the message */
+	sof_mailbox_write(sdev, sdev->host_box.offset, msg->msg_data,
+			  msg->msg_size);
+	snd_sof_dsp_write(sdev, HDA_DSP_BAR, CNL_DSP_REG_HIPCIDR,
+			  cmd | CNL_DSP_REG_HIPCIDR_BUSY);
+
+	return 0;
+}
